AI编写代码的安全性如何?

随着人工智能(AI)技术的飞速发展,AI编写代码已经成为现实。然而,这种新兴的技术也引发了许多关于安全性的担忧。本文将从多个角度探讨AI编写代码的安全性,并分析如何提高其安全性。

一、AI编写代码的安全性担忧

  1. 代码质量不稳定

AI编写代码的效率较高,但代码质量却存在不稳定的问题。由于AI在编写代码时,可能受到输入数据、算法模型等因素的影响,导致生成的代码存在漏洞、错误或不符合实际需求。


  1. 代码版权问题

AI编写代码的过程中,可能涉及到大量开源代码和他人作品。如何界定AI编写代码的版权归属,以及如何避免侵权问题,成为一大难题。


  1. 代码被恶意利用

AI编写代码可能被恶意利用,如生成恶意软件、网络攻击工具等。若AI编写代码的安全性得不到保障,将给网络安全带来巨大威胁。


  1. 代码泄露风险

AI编写代码过程中,可能涉及敏感信息。一旦代码泄露,将可能导致商业机密、个人隐私等信息泄露。

二、提高AI编写代码安全性的措施

  1. 加强代码审查

在AI编写代码的过程中,加强代码审查是提高安全性的关键。通过人工审查,可以发现代码中的漏洞、错误,确保代码质量。


  1. 严格版权管理

对于AI编写代码过程中使用的开源代码和他人作品,应严格进行版权管理。在编写代码前,确保已获取相关版权授权,避免侵权问题。


  1. 强化代码加密

对AI编写代码过程中产生的敏感信息进行加密处理,降低泄露风险。同时,加强对加密算法的研究,提高加密强度。


  1. 完善安全机制

在AI编写代码过程中,完善安全机制,如设置访问权限、审计日志等。对代码进行实时监控,一旦发现异常,立即采取措施。


  1. 培养专业人才

提高AI编写代码的安全性,离不开专业人才的培养。加强对AI安全领域的教育和研究,培养一批具有安全意识和技能的专业人才。


  1. 加强国际合作

在全球范围内,加强AI编写代码安全性的国际合作,共同应对安全挑战。通过共享技术、经验,提高全球AI编写代码的安全性。

三、总结

AI编写代码作为一种新兴技术,具有巨大的发展潜力。然而,其安全性问题也不容忽视。通过加强代码审查、严格版权管理、强化代码加密、完善安全机制、培养专业人才和加强国际合作等措施,可以有效提高AI编写代码的安全性。在未来,随着AI技术的不断发展和完善,AI编写代码的安全性将得到更好的保障。

猜你喜欢:专业医疗器械翻译